A rare opportunity to see Australia’s ‘Inbound Sea’ transformed with the arrival of recent floodwaters.
Lake Eyre, or Kati Thanda-Lake Eyre, is an outback lake so vast in size it crosses the borders of 3 different states. This immense salt lake, usually a shimmering dry basin, is an extraordinary blend on sparkling yellows, reds, and browns, acting as a reminder of the rugged beauty, and incredible isolation of the Australian outback.
Following significant rainfall in Western Queensland, flood waters are moving down the Diamantina River into the Channel Country, and are set to enter Lake Eyre – an event usually occurring only every 6 – 8 years. The parched earth of Lake Eyre and its surrounds bursts into life following the arrival of water, transforming this usually desolate landscape into a wilderness rich in native wildlife, and rejuvenated plant species.
